Introduction
Bitcoin is a digital currency that has gained significant popularity in recent years. It is a decentralized cryptocurrency, which means that it is not controlled by any central authority or government. Instead, Bitcoin is maintained by a network of computers around the world. Bitcoin is stored in digital wallets, which can be either software-based or hardware-based. In order to log into a Bitcoin account, you will need to have a Bitcoin wallet and the associated login credentials.
Software Wallets
Software wallets are digital wallets that are stored on your computer or mobile device. They are convenient to use, as you can access your Bitcoin wallet from anywhere with an internet connection. However, software wallets are also more susceptible to hacking, as they are stored online. Some popular software wallets include Exodus, Coinbase, and Electrum.
Hardware Wallets
Hardware wallets are physical devices that store your Bitcoin offline. They are more secure than software wallets, as they are not connected to the internet. However, hardware wallets are also more expensive than software wallets. Some popular hardware wallets include Trezor, Ledger, and KeepKey.

Security Tips
When logging into your Bitcoin account, it is important to take the following security precautions:
Use a strong password.
Enable two-factor authentication.
Keep your software wallet or hardware wallet up to date with the latest security patches.
Never share your login credentials with anyone.
Be aware of phishing scams.
By following these security tips, you can help to protect your Bitcoin account from unauthorized access.
